RadiatorThe medieval village Castelmuzio, known as the "living room village" for its order and elegance, is a very beautiful, compact, well-maintained and well-restored village. It is also beautiful from a panoramic point of view. From the panoramic terrace of the walls, which overlooks the Trove torrent valley, you can see extraordinary varieties of olive groves, vineyards, cypress groves, woods, cultivated fields and farmhouses and you can admire a vast view that includes Montepulciano, Radicofani, Pienza, Amiata and the Val d'Orcia, Montalcino, the Val d'Arbia and Siena. In the village we have a bar, a restaurant and a supermarket. It can be reached from both the North and the South by exiting at the Val di Chiana highway toll booth, the village is about 20 minutes away.
